北方粳稻花药培养力及配合力分析  被引量:7

Analysis of Anther Culture Ability and Combining Ability in the North Japonica Rice

摘  要:通过对北方粳稻8个品种及44不完全双列杂交F1的愈伤诱导率、绿苗分化率和花药培养力及相应的配合力的分析,为北方粳稻花培育种的亲本选配提供参考。研究结果表明:(1)不同基因型的愈伤诱导率、绿苗分化率和花药培养力有明显差异,杂种F1的愈伤诱导率、绿苗分化率和花药培养力介于双亲之间而偏向母本。(2)不同亲本的一般配合力以及不同组合的特殊配合力存在明显差异,愈伤诱导率、绿苗分化率和花药培养力的遗传主要由核基因控制的,存在基因的加性和非加性效应。This study analyzed callus induction rate, green seedling differentiation rate, anther culture ability and corresponding combining ability of north japonica rice, including 8 cultivars and 16 hybrids F1 of incom- plete diallel cross,providing reference for parental hybridization of the north japonica rice anther culture. The results show that : ( 1 ) callus induction rate, green seedling differentiation rate and anther culture ability appeared to be significant difference among different genotypes, and above traits of hybrids Fl were among parents and deviation to maternal. (2) General combining ability of different parents and special combining ability of different combinations appeared to be obvious difference, the genetic of callus induction rate, green seedling differentiation rate and anther culture ability was mainly dominated by nuclear gene,had great additive effects and non-additive effects.
